NAV Canada: Powering Canada’s Skies
NAV Canada is the unsung hero behind the safe and efficient movement of aircraft across 18 million square kilometers of Canadian airspace.
This private, non-profit organization oversees a vast network of air traffic control towers, flight service stations, maintenance centers, and cutting-edge navigation systems.

1. Air Traffic Controller: Guide the Skies, Earn Big
Salary: $56,899–$59,550 during training; $101,221–$201,407 post-training
Location: Various locations across Canada
Who Should Apply: If you’re 18 or older, hold a high school diploma (or equivalent), and are a Canadian citizen or permanent resident, this could be your dream job.
You must be willing to relocate to one of NAV Canada’s air traffic control locations.
What You’ll Do: As an air traffic controller, you’ll be the eyes and ears of the skies, ensuring aircraft move safely and efficiently.
This high-stakes role requires sharp decision-making, excellent communication, and the ability to stay calm under pressure.

4. Surveillance Systems Engineer: Innovate for Safety
Salary: $111,451–$140,007
Location: Ottawa, ON
Who Should Apply: You’ll need a degree in electrical, electronic, computer, or aerospace engineering and eligibility for certification as a Professional Engineer in Canada.
Experience in hardware/software projects and resolving lifecycle performance issues with surveillance systems (e.g., Multilateration, Automatic Dependent Surveillance Broadcast) is essential.
Key Knowledge Areas:
- Engineering principles for air traffic control
- Emerging technologies like RF propagation and signal processing
- Scaled Agile Framework (SAFe) and project management
